A sample of the amounts spent to heat all-electric homes of similar sizes in March revealed these amounts (to the nearest dollar): $212, $191, $176, $129, $106, $92, $108, $109, $103, $121, $175 and $194. What is the range?

  1. $130
  2. $100
  3. $120
  4. None of these answers
  5. $112

Answer(s): C

Explanation:

Range = 212 - 92 = 120



A dataset of 105 observations is organized in a relative frequency distribution into 9 classes. The sum of the relative frequencies across all the classes equals ________.

  1. 9
  2. 1
  3. 105
  4. 100

Answer(s): B

Explanation:

Relative class frequencies are percentages and across all classes, they must sum up to 100%, which is the same as summing up to 1.00.



A portfolio manager has estimated the beta of a stock at 0.8, with a z-statistic of 1.7 in a sample size of 300 observations. At 5% significance level in a two-sided test the critical value is 1.96, therefore, the manager should conclude that:

  1. the null hypothesis of beta = 0 cannot be rejected.
  2. the null hypothesis of beta = 0 cannot be accepted.
  3. the alternative hypothesis that beta is nonzero should be rejected.
  4. the alternative hypothesis that beta is not zero should be accepted.

Answer(s): A

Explanation:

Since the z-statistic is less than the critical value of 1.96 in a two-sided test, the null hypothesis that beta = 0 cannot be rejected. Note, however, that this does not imply that beta equals zero. It just says that with the given observations, one cannot conclude that beta is statistically significantly different from zero. This is always the interpretation of the null hypothesis (that's the reason statisticians emphasize that "failing to reject the null hypothesis" is not the same as "accepting the null hypothesis." You should always remember this.) Also note that the nature of the alternative hypothesis is important. If the alternative had been onesided (beta > 0), then the null would be rejected in this case at the 5% level.



Which of the following is NOT a measure of dispersion?

  1. MAD
  2. variance
  3. mode
  4. range

Answer(s): C

Explanation:

The mode is a measure of central tendency.
